In Category Theory, what is a functor?

AnswerClick to flip back
A
A mapping between two categories that preserves their structure.
💡 Explanation:

A functor is a structure-preserving mapping between categories. It assigns objects of one category to objects of another category and morphisms of one category to morphisms of another category in a way that preserves composition and identities.
